The actress in question is Javicia Leslie, who was announced as the new Batwoman in December 2020. The decision to cast an African-American actress in the role was met with both excitement and skepticism. On one hand, fans were thrilled to see a character that has historically been represented by white actors finally being portrayed by a person of color. On the other hand, some were concerned that the character’s identity and legacy might be compromised in the process.
Leslie’s portrayal of Batwoman in the CW series “Batwoman” has been met with mixed reviews. Some viewers have praised her performance, noting her strong chemistry with her costars and her ability to bring a fresh perspective to the character. Others, however, have criticized her for not embodying the traditional Batwoman look and demeanor, which has been a staple of the character since her inception.
